What are impact windows?

Impact windows are specially designed to withstand extreme weather. They feature laminated glass and reinforced frames, offering superior protection against high winds and flying debris. This durability is crucial for Washington's unpredictable storm seasons.

Can you install impact windows yourself?

DIY installation of impact windows is not recommended. Proper sealing and structural integration are critical for optimal performance. Our certified installers in Washington ensure correct fitting and maximum protection.
